The Role of Sustainable Living in Web Development
As the world becomes increasingly digital, the environmental impact of web development has become a pressing concern. The production and consumption of digital products, such as websites and applications, have significant effects on the environment, from energy consumption to e-waste generation. In recent years, there has been a growing recognition of the need for sustainable living practices in web development. This article will explore the intersection of sustainable living and web development, highlighting the benefits and challenges of adopting eco-friendly practices in the industry.
The web development industry has a significant carbon footprint, primarily due to the energy consumption of data centers, servers, and devices. According to a report by the Natural Resources Defense Council, the production and consumption of digital products account for around 3.7% of global greenhouse gas emissions. This is comparable to the carbon footprint of the aviation industry. Furthermore, the rapid pace of technological advancements and the resulting obsolescence of devices contribute to the growing problem of e-waste.
The Benefits of Sustainable Web Development
Adopting sustainable living practices in web development can have numerous benefits, both for the environment and for businesses. One of the primary advantages of sustainable web development is reduced energy consumption. By optimizing website performance, minimizing HTTP requests, and using energy-efficient servers, developers can significantly reduce the carbon footprint of their digital products. Additionally, sustainable web development can lead to cost savings, improved user experience, and enhanced brand reputation.
Sustainable Web Development Practices
So, what can web developers do to adopt sustainable living practices in their work? Here are some strategies:
- Optimize website performance: Minimize HTTP requests, compress files, and leverage browser caching to reduce energy consumption.
- Use energy-efficient servers: Choose servers that use renewable energy sources, such as solar or wind power.
- Design for longevity: Create digital products that are designed to last, reducing the need for frequent updates and replacements.
- Use sustainable coding practices: Write efficient code that minimizes energy consumption and reduces e-waste.

Challenges and Limitations of Sustainable Web Development
While sustainable web development has numerous benefits, there are also challenges and limitations to adopting eco-friendly practices in the industry. One of the primary challenges is the lack of awareness and education among developers and businesses. Many developers and businesses are not aware of the environmental impacts of web development, or they do not know how to adopt sustainable living practices. Additionally, sustainable web development often requires significant investments in new technologies and practices, which can be costly and time-consuming.
